Zabbixサーバの状態のZabbixサーバの起動の値が「いいえ」となっています。
WEBフロントのダッシュボードのZabbixサーバの起動の値が「いいえ」となっています。
サーバーで/etc/init.d/zabbix-server start で[OK]となっています。
service zabbix-server start でも[OK]となっています
ログですが
zabbix_server_mysql[7123]ERROR File[/var/run/zabbix/zabbix_server.pid] exists and is locked. Is this process already runninng?
ただ、監視はできています。モニターにDISK容量などの値はすべて表示されています。
何が原因でしょうか?
KAZ - 投稿数: 1085
help_kusaさん
同じ質問をフォーラムでされている人がいましたよ。
zabbix_server_mysqlでZABBIX-JPサイトを検索するとわかるかと。
help_kusa - 投稿数: 33
伊藤さん
いつも、お世話になります。
検索しところ、以下がヒットしました。
http://www.zabbix.jp/modules/newbb/viewtopic.php?topic_id=475&forum=5&post_id=2348#forumpost2348
消し方とありますが、プロセス監視はまだ実施していないため、
できないようです。
KAZ - 投稿数: 1085
help_kusaさん
えーっと…A(^^;
ソースをコンパイルインストール(configure)するとZabbixサーバのプロセスはzabbix_serverとなります。
rpmインストールするとZabbixサーバのプロセスはzabbix_server_mysqlとなります。
Zabbixサーバのプロセスが起動していれば、表示がバグってます。
Zabbixサーバが正常に上がっていればOKとなるのが正しい状態です。
1.6系のrpmでも発生していました。
デグレードしたかもしれません。
起動ファイルの修正に失敗していないでしょうか?
pidファイルが消えていないので2重起動しているように言えると言ってます。
help_kusa - 投稿数: 33
ありがとうございます。
トリガーの追加で、条件式を以下にするとエラーがでます。
{zabbixtest:proc.num[zabbix_server_mysql].last(0)}<1
No such monitored parameter (proc.num[zabbix_server_mysql]) for host (zabbixtest)
zabbix_server_mysqlのプロセスを監視する設定にしていのですが。。。
help_kusa - 投稿数: 33
ありがとうございます。
トリガーを追加しようと条件式を以下にするとエラーがでます。
{zabbixtest:proc.num[zabbix_server_mysql].last(0)}=0
No such monitored parameter (proc.num[zabbix_server_mysql]) for host (zabbixtest)
zabbix_server_mysqlを監視対象にすれば、回避されると思ったのですが。。。
KAZ - 投稿数: 1085
help_kusaさん
アイテムはどの様に[d]等るク[/d]登録されていますか?
help_kusa - 投稿数: 33
伊藤さん
proc.num[zabbix_server_mysql]
Number of running processes $1
です。
KAZ - 投稿数: 1085
help_kusaさん
登録したアイテムの情報は収集できていますか?
TNK - 投稿数: 4768
監視できているにも関わらず、ダッシュボードのZabbixサーバの起動が「いいえ」になっているのであれば、WebUIの初期設定時と現在のzabbix-serverの設定の不一致かもしれません。
zabbix.conf.phpの内容をご確認下さい。
RPMでインストールした場合は、以下のファイルになると思います。
/usr/share/zabbix/conf/zabbix.conf.php
具体的には、以下の箇所をご確認下さい。
<code>
$ZBX_SERVER = 'IPアドレス';
$ZBX_SERVER_PORT = '10051';
</code>